* 本算法用最小二乘法依據(jù)指定的M個(gè)基函數(shù)及N個(gè)已知數(shù)據(jù)進(jìn)行曲線擬和 * 輸入: m--已知數(shù)據(jù)點(diǎn)的個(gè)數(shù)M * f--M維基函數(shù)向量 * n--已知數(shù)據(jù)點(diǎn)的個(gè)數(shù)N-1 * x--已知數(shù)據(jù)點(diǎn)第一坐標(biāo)的N維列向量 * y--已知數(shù)據(jù)點(diǎn)第二坐標(biāo)的N維列向量 * a--無用 * 輸出: 函數(shù)返回值為曲線擬和的均方誤差 * a為用基函數(shù)進(jìn)行曲線擬和的系數(shù), * 即a[0]f[0]+a[1]f[1]+...+a[M]f[M].
標(biāo)簽: 數(shù)據(jù) 函數(shù) 算法 最小二乘法
上傳時(shí)間: 2015-07-26
上傳用戶:
學(xué)生信息管理系統(tǒng),本程序共有八個(gè)功能與數(shù)據(jù)結(jié)構(gòu)說明: 每一條記錄包括一個(gè)學(xué)生的學(xué)號(hào)、姓名、3門課成績、平均成績。 1.學(xué)生記錄的輸入,可以一次完成若干條記錄的輸入,可以控制所要輸入學(xué)生的總數(shù),根據(jù)提示進(jìn)行輸入次數(shù),然后每輸入一個(gè)值按下回車,然后再根據(jù)提示進(jìn)行輸入。 2.顯示學(xué)生信息。完成全部學(xué)生記錄的顯示。 3.查找功能。輸入一個(gè)學(xué)生的名字,然后就顯示該學(xué)生的所有信息。 4.排序功能:按學(xué)生平均成績進(jìn)行排序。 5.插入記錄。在程序進(jìn)行中可以輸入一個(gè)學(xué)生的名字,然后在該學(xué)生后面插入一個(gè)學(xué)生的信息,插入完之后會(huì)提示用戶是否進(jìn)行排序,輸入y則進(jìn)行排序,輸入n不進(jìn)行排序。 6.刪除功能。該功能實(shí)現(xiàn)刪除學(xué)生信息,給出所要?jiǎng)h除的學(xué)生的名字,即可實(shí)現(xiàn)將該學(xué)生的所有信息刪除。 7.文件的存盤功能。該功能模塊實(shí)現(xiàn)對(duì)該文件的存盤操作。將文件存入磁盤中的命名為student.cpp的文件中,直到存完為止。 8.文件的讀出功能。該功能模塊實(shí)現(xiàn)對(duì)磁盤中文件名為student.cpp的文件進(jìn)行讀出操作,直到讀完為止。 9.則退出整個(gè)程序的運(yùn)行。
標(biāo)簽: 記錄 信息管理系統(tǒng) 程序 數(shù)據(jù)結(jié)構(gòu)
上傳時(shí)間: 2013-12-19
上傳用戶:李彥東
Problem A:放蘋果 Time Limit:1000MS Memory Limit:65536K Total Submit:1094 Accepted:441 Language: not limited Description 把M個(gè)同樣的蘋果放在N個(gè)同樣的盤子里,允許有的盤子空著不放,問共有多少種不同的分法?(用K表示)5,1,1和1,5,1 是同一種分法。 Input 第一行是測試數(shù)據(jù)的數(shù)目t(0 <= t <= 20)。以下每行均包含二個(gè)整數(shù)M和N,以空格分開。1<=M,N<=10。 Output 對(duì)輸入的每組數(shù)據(jù)M和N,用一行輸出相應(yīng)的K。 Sample Input 1 7 3 Sample Output 8
標(biāo)簽: Limit Accepted Language Problem
上傳時(shí)間: 2016-11-30
上傳用戶:leixinzhuo
C# ArrayList C++模仿版,只支持最簡單的動(dòng)態(tài)隊(duì)列操作,采用雙層鏈表,支持16兆以上個(gè)對(duì)象的隊(duì)列管理。 效率:查找上界O(988+N/976144),插入及刪除上界O(988+N/976144+N*T(create/delete
上傳時(shí)間: 2013-12-11
上傳用戶:tianjinfan
輪廓問題的源代碼,輸入文件的格式為第一行是輪廓個(gè)數(shù),接下來的n行為對(duì)每一個(gè)輪廓的描述:起始坐標(biāo),高度,結(jié)束坐標(biāo)。輸出文件即為輸入文件的輪廓
上傳時(shí)間: 2017-01-27
上傳用戶:宋桃子
最小生成樹 MST的四種算法實(shí)現(xiàn)。 包括普通的Kruskal算法和Prim算法,用Disjoint-Set優(yōu)化的Kruskal算法和用Heap優(yōu)化的堆算法。 復(fù)雜度分別為O(mn), O(n^2), O(m log n), O(m log n)
上傳時(shí)間: 2013-12-10
上傳用戶:stewart·
verilog的簡要教程 基本邏輯門,例如a n d、o r和n a n d等都內(nèi)置在語言中。 • 用戶定義原語( U D P)創(chuàng)建的靈活性。用戶定義的原語既可以是組合邏輯原語,也可以 是時(shí)序邏輯原語。 • 開關(guān)級(jí)基本結(jié)構(gòu)模型,例如p m o s 和n m o s等也被內(nèi)置在語言中。
上傳時(shí)間: 2017-05-05
上傳用戶:1583060504
實(shí)驗(yàn)源代碼 //Warshall.cpp #include<stdio.h> void warshall(int k,int n) { int i , j, t; int temp[20][20]; for(int a=0;a<k;a++) { printf("請(qǐng)輸入矩陣第%d 行元素:",a); for(int b=0;b<n;b++) { scanf ("%d",&temp[a][b]); } } for(i=0;i<k;i++){ for( j=0;j<k;j++){ if(temp[ j][i]==1) { for(t=0;t<n;t++) { temp[ j][t]=temp[i][t]||temp[ j][t]; } } } } printf("可傳遞閉包關(guān)系矩陣是:\n"); for(i=0;i<k;i++) { for( j=0;j<n;j++) { printf("%d", temp[i][ j]); } printf("\n"); } } void main() { printf("利用 Warshall 算法求二元關(guān)系的可傳遞閉包\n"); void warshall(int,int); int k , n; printf("請(qǐng)輸入矩陣的行數(shù) i: "); scanf("%d",&k); 四川大學(xué)實(shí)驗(yàn)報(bào)告 printf("請(qǐng)輸入矩陣的列數(shù) j: "); scanf("%d",&n); warshall(k,n); }
標(biāo)簽: warshall 離散 實(shí)驗(yàn)
上傳時(shí)間: 2016-06-27
上傳用戶:梁雪文以
USB是PC體系中的一套全新的工業(yè)標(biāo)準(zhǔn),它支持單個(gè)主機(jī)與多個(gè)外接設(shè)備同時(shí)進(jìn)行數(shù)據(jù)交換。 首先會(huì)介紹USB的結(jié)構(gòu)和特點(diǎn),包括總線特徵、協(xié)議定義、傳輸方式和電源管理等等。這部分內(nèi)容會(huì)使USB開發(fā)者和用戶對(duì)USB有一整體的認(rèn)識(shí)。
標(biāo)簽: USB
上傳時(shí)間: 2015-10-18
上傳用戶:lixinxiang
標(biāo)準(zhǔn)滑 鼠應(yīng)用程式, 其中包含: X, Y座標(biāo)輸入 固定時(shí)間輸出X,Y座標(biāo)值給主機(jī). 按鍵輸入 固定時(shí)間輸出按鍵值給主機(jī).
上傳時(shí)間: 2013-12-21
上傳用戶:aeiouetla
蟲蟲下載站版權(quán)所有 京ICP備2021023401號(hào)-1